Friday Morning Hike from Gateway Access Trailhead - DECEMBER Version

 

We'll meet near the restrooms at the Gateway entrance to Scottsdale's McDowell Sonoran Preserve.   This hike will be paced at a mild rate, not an extreme fast fitness pace. These hikes will start on time and the expectation is that it will end at or before the stated end time for those who do need to get to work.

This is a recurring Friday morning hike starting from the Gateway Access trailhead. Now the temperatures have dropped and we are coming into hiking season we will start the hike later in the mornings.The hikes may vary each week, but will be 5 miles or less in length and should be done in 1:30 to 2:00.

The trails in this area are very well marked and easy to follow with just a little preparation.  If you have any questions, please send a message to one of the organizers.

Bring lots of water, snacks, and a camera.

Trail Length: Gateway Loop 4.42 miles

Time: 2 hours

Elevation Gain: 800 feet

Difficulty: Moderate
Facilities: Restrooms, water
Trail Style: lollipop style
